Valuation Metrics
Right now, Alibaba Group Holding Limited (BABA) has a P/E ratio of about 20.04. The stock’s beta is 0.64. Besides these, the trailing price-to-sales (P/S) ratio of 1.69, the price-to-book (PB) ratio of 1.45.
Financial Health
In the three months ended March 30, Alibaba Group Holding Limited’s quick ratio stood at 1.80, while its current ratio was 1.80, showing that the company is able to pay off its debt. According to company report, the long-term debt-to-equity ratio for the quarter ending March 30 was 0.15, and the total debt-to-equity ratio was 0.16. On the profitability front, the trailing twelve-month gross margin is 36.70% percent. In the year ended March 30, operating margins totaled 11.60%. Based on annual data, BABA earned $49.47 billion in gross profit and brought in $134.57 billion in revenue.
A company’s management is another factor that investors consider when determining the profitability of an investment. In the past year, return on investment (ROI) was 7.40%. Return on equity (ROE) for the past 12 months was 7.50%.
In Alibaba Group Holding Limited’s quarter-end financial report for March 30, it reported total debt of $20.71 billion.
